Most canine childcare centers need a meet and greet prior to you enroll your puppy, and most have a minimum dog-to-staff proportion of one staff member per fifteen pets. This helps make sure that there is an enough amount of guidance accessible in case a scuffle or injury occurs during play. In addition, staff members need to be able to track each pet dog's health and wellness standing, administer medicines as needed, and respond to inquiries from pet parents.
Staffing is a major expense for most dog-centric companies, and it is very important to pay team all right to make sure that they really feel valued and encouraged. This aids to develop a satisfied and healthy and balanced workplace, which consequently brings about a better total experience for the dogs. Some centers also have additional income streams that assist balance out some of the costs associated with running a doggy daycare, such as pet grooming and over night boarding solutions.
Some pet dogs have plentiful energy and need more than simply skipping about with their close friends to melt it off. Some centers use specialized take care of these pups, including more individually focus and additional activities. Some of these added solutions might set you back $10 or even more a day.
